Abstract
Repeated precise measurements of three lines of the California geodimeter network near Danville, California, were undertaken beginning 2 weeks before the largest (ML = 4.25) events in the Danville eathquake swarm and extending over 5 months. The measurements suggest that changes in length of about 1 cm in a direction consistent with right-lateral slip on the Pleasanton fault may have occurred at about the time of the largest shocks.
